Position Summary:

Reporting to the Director of Meetings & Corporate Development, the Senior Manager, Meetings & Conventions will deliver operational and strategic oversight for departmental and organizational objectives, managing all facets of meeting planning. Additionally, this role will provide operational support for budgeting and the development of standard operating procedures while assisting volunteer leaders with strategic planning initiatives.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Develop and monitor operational plans, timelines, and contract management for the annual conference and other events.
  • Oversee contractual agreements for departmental functions, including venues, hotels, media suppliers, and other service providers.
  • Maintain professional relationships with service providers, ensuring high-functioning collaboration.
  • Manage the registration process, including system setup, form processing, payment collection, and reporting.
  • Coordinate logistics for the annual conference, including audio-visual needs and food & beverage arrangements.
  • Support corporate-sponsored programs to ensure alignment with program objectives.
  • Facilitate logistics for smaller meetings and functions.
  • Collaborate with the Education & Research department on survey evaluations.
  • Lead the Awards Committee, including scheduling meetings and managing award applications.
  • Create and maintain content for the annual conference website and mobile app.
  • Assist with the House of Delegates and policy changes.
  • Generate reports for the finance department.
  • Manage small regional meetings.
  • Serve as the primary contact for event sponsors and internal teams.
  • Source hotels, negotiate contracts, and manage meeting specifications.
  • Provide onsite support for both in-person and virtual meetings.
  • Coordinate with marketing to produce event materials and communications.
  • Compile post-event reports detailing registration, financials, and attendee feedback.
  • Support the implementation of strategic and operational plans.
  • Assist with membership recruitment and retention initiatives.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
